Bulgaria’s top female tennis player Viktoriya Tomova qualified for the semifinals of the clay court championship in Saragossa with USD 80,000 in prize money.
The No. 2 seeded player won versus Irene Burillo, Spain, playing on a wild card, by 6-3, 6-4, and will continue without having lost a set. By reaching the semifinals, Viktoriya Tomova wins 48 world ranking points, occupying 98th position.
